Determining Sanitary Sewer Assessment Rates <br /> a) Sanitary Sewer Interceptor Rates <br /> All properties which lie within the approved Service District <br /> shall bear the cost of sanitary sewer interceptor projects. The <br /> costs shall be spread equally based on a gross area basis within <br /> the Service District and will be known as an interceptor <br /> • assessment. • <br /> b) Sanitary Sewer Trunk/Subtrunk Rates <br /> The lateral and building service assessments described below will <br /> be deducted from the total improvement cost to be assessed. The <br /> amount remaining after said deductions will be assessed on a gross <br /> area basis to all properties within the Service District, and will <br /> be known as a trunk assessment and/or subtrunk assessment. <br /> c) Sanitary Sewer Lateral Rates <br /> The building service assessments described below will be deducted <br /> from the total improvement cost to be assessed. The amount <br /> remaining after said deductions will be assessed by the following <br /> method.
